E Enacting and modifying the Uniform Limited Partnership Act 2001; + regulating the organization, structure and governance of business corporations, +nonprofit corporations and limited liability companies ARTICLE 1 � GENERAL PROVISIONSDefining certain terms; describing persons knowing and having notice +of facts; providing for the nature, purpose and duration of entities; +specifying the powers of limited partnerships; designating the governing law and +specifying the supplemental principles of law; establishing the rate of +interest; regulating the selection, use and reservation of names; specifying +the effect of partnership agreements and certain information maintenance +requirements; regulating business transactions; authorizing and providing for the +dual capacity of partners; requiring the designation of an office and +agent for service of process; providing for the consent and proxies of partners ARTICLE 2 - FORMATION; CERTIFICATE OF LIMITED PARTNERSHIP AND OTHER +FILINGSProviding for the formation of limited partnerships and the filing of+ a certificate and a statement of termination; specifying certain +records signing and filing and report requirements and certain duties of the +secretary of state ARTICLE 3 � LIMITED PARTNERSProviding for the rights and responsibilities of limited partners ARTICLE 4 � GENERAL PARTNERS Providing for the rights and responsibilities and regulating the +conduct of general partners; providing for the transfer of partnership property ARTICLE 5 � CONTRIBUTIONS AND DISTRIBUTIONSProviding for the form of and specifying liability for contributions;+ requiring the sharing of distributions, specifying certain restrictions and +limits; imposing liability for improper distributions ARTICLE 6 � DISSOCIATIONRegulating dissociation from limited partnerships, providing for +effect and specifying liability ARTICLE 7 � TRANSFERABLE INTERESTS AND RIGHTS OF TRANSFEREES AND +CREDITORSRegulating the transfer of partner interest; specifying the rights of+ creditors of partners or transferees; providing for the power of estate of +deceased partners ARTICLE 8 � DISSOLUTIONRegulating the dissolution of limited partnerships; providing for +nonjudicial, judicial and administrative dissolution and dissociation after +dissolution; specifying certain winding up requirements and options; providing for+ the disposal of claims; authorizing and providing for reinstatement after administrative dissolution; providing for the disposition of assets ARTICLE 9 � FOREIGN LIMITED PARTNERSHIPSDesignating the governing law for foreign limited partnerships and +providing for application for and filing and revocation or cancellation of +certificates of authority to transact business in the state; specifying the +activities not constituting business transactions; providing for name compliance; +authorizing the attorney general to maintain actions to restrain foreign limited partnerships from transacting business in the state in violation of +the requirements ARTICLE 10 � ACTIONS BY PARTNERSAuthorizing and providing for certain direct and derivative actions +by partners ARTICLE 11 � CONVERSION AND MERGERRegulating conversions and mergers of limited partnerships; defining +certain terms; specifying certain plan and articles of conversion or merger requirements and providing for the effect; specifying certain +restrictions on approval of conversions and mergers and the liability and general +powers of partners after conversion or merger; providing for certain conflicts ARTICLE 12 � MISCELLANEOUS PROVISIONSProviding uniform application of the provisions; severability and +savings clauses; specifying the relation to the federal electronic signatures+ in global and national commerce act and for the application to existing +relationships; providing for the effect of limited partnership designation; +repealing the existing uniform limited partnership act (1976) ARTICLE 13 � CONFORMING CHANGES Making conforming changes to certain provisions relating to the +service of process and corporate names; correcting the definition of record +under the uniform limited partnership act of 1994ARTICLE 14 � OTHER BUSINESS ORGANIZATIONSModifying certain provisions regulating the organization, structure +and governance of business corporations, nonprofit corporations and +limited liability companies; defining or redefining certain terms; requiring +the signing by all shareholders of written actions; modifying the right +of shareholders to vote as a class or series on proposed amendments; +regulating the election of directors; providing for the effectiveness of +electronic communication of board meeting notices; filing of amendments to filed statements to be considered amendments of the articles of +incorporation; providing for action without a meeting by nonpublic corporations and +requiring notice to and specifying the liability of shareholders for notice of +written actions; expanding the actions allowing shareholder dissent, +regulating the right to obtain payment and modifying certain requirements for notice+ of dissent; expanding the definition of official capacity for +indemnification purposes; creating an exception to the requirement for shareholder +approval of asset transfers; regulating the conversion of corporations and +limited liability companies, specifying certain plan and articles +requirements and providing for the effect, effectiveness and abandonment of +conversions; providing for the effectiveness of electronic communication of +nonprofit corporation board meetings and authorizing electronic communication +of action ballots under certain conditions; modifying the right of owners of +outstanding membership interests of LLCs to class or series voting on amendments +to the articles of organization; requiring the approval of members entitled +to vote on amendments to articles or member control agreements to permit written+ action by less than all members; expanding the right of dissenters to obtain +payment for the fair value of membership interests and modifying certain notice requirements; filing of amendments to company statements to be +considered amendments of the articles of organization; regulating the election +of governors and providing for the effectiveness of electronic +communication of board meeting notices; creating an exception to the requirement for +member approval of asset transfers ARTICLE 15 � FISCAL YEAR 2005 FUNDINGSetting certain limited and foreign limited partnership filing fees, +sunset; appropriating money to the secretary of state for provisions +implementation purposes (je, ja)
